Discuss chemical properties of sulphur dioxide gas.
Chemical properties of sulphur dioxide gas are:
Reaction with gas:
i. When sulphur dioxide gas is passed through the solution of sodium hydroxide, sodium sulphite is formed.
SO2 + NaOH → Na2SO3 + H2O
Sodium
sulphite
ii. When sulphur dioxide gas is passed through the lime water, lime water becomes milky and calcium sulphite is formed.
SO2 + Ca(OH)2→ CaSO3 + H2O
Lime Calcium
water sulphite
Reaction with dioxygen gas:
When sulphur dioxide gas is passed through dioxygen gas in the presence of V2O5 catalyst, sulphur trioxide is formed.
2SO2 + O2→ 2SO3
Sulphur trioxide
Reaction with hydrogen sulphide gas (H2S) :
When sulphur dioxide gas is passed through hydrogen sulphide gas, sulphur is formed.
2SO2 + H2S → 3S + 2H2O
